#00a9b8 - Bluebird color

A bright, invigorating teal with equal parts cool blue and lively green, this hue reads as modern and refreshing. It evokes clear tropical waters and crisp, minty freshness, balancing calming depth with energetic vibrancy. Highly saturated yet not harsh, it works well for contemporary branding, tech interfaces, and accents that need visibility without overwhelming. Pair it with warm corals, deep navy, or soft neutrals to create contrast and harmony; it conveys clarity, approachability, and a confident, youthful spirit.

color #00a9b8

#00a9b8 color RGB value is 0, 169, 184, and the CMYK value is 1.00, 0.0815, 0.00, 0.278. Alternative names for that color are: bluebird, teal, lightseagreen, pelorous, pacific blue, green.
